Cork North Central Poll Suggests 2 Seats for FF, 2 Seats for Alternative

Great stuff, another local poll. Cork North Central is under the microscope for the Echo. It is a four-seater this year (down from five). Was a 3-1-1 but one incumbent FF is retiring so the incumbency is 2-1-1 for the four seater. The poll predicts that Fianna Fail are likely to have a pretty major [...]

Split Worries for West Cork Fianna Fail

Missed this earlier this morning, it appears senior handlers in Fianna Fail are worried about a possible split in the party in West Cork. The NEC have finalised the Fianna Fail candidates to go forward in Cork South West however they decided a convention was surplus to requirements.
